INDUSTRIAL / COMMERCIAL ELECTRICAL DIVISION

Job Title : Lead Electrician

Job Description :

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Lead Electrician to join our team. As the Lead Electrician, you will play a crucial role in overseeing electrical projects, leading a team of electricians, conducting site surveys, and building accurate quotes for material and labor.

Your expertise, attention to detail, and leadership abilities will be instrumental in ensuring the successful execution of projects and the delivery of high-quality electrical services.

Responsibilities :

  • Project Assessment and Site Surveys :
  • Conduct thorough site surveys to assess the scope of work, identify electrical requirements, and gather necessary information.
  • Collaborate with clients, contractors, and team members to understand project specifications and objectives.
  • Provide recommendations and insights based on your technical expertise to optimize project planning and execution.
  • Building Accurate Quotes :
  • Utilize your knowledge and experience to estimate material and labor requirements for electrical projects.
  • Consider factors such as project complexity, timelines, and regulatory compliance to provide accurate and competitive quotes.
  • Collaborate with procurement and estimating teams to ensure the availability and cost-effectiveness of materials.
  • Team Leadership and Supervision :
  • Lead a team of electricians, providing guidance, support, and mentorship to ensure efficient and high-quality work.
  • Assign tasks, set priorities, and monitor progress to ensure timely completion of projects.
  •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ment that promotes teamwork, growth, and professional development.
  • Quality Control and Safety Compliance :
  • Maintain a strong focus on quality control, ensuring that all work adheres to industry standards, codes, and safety regulations.
  • Conduct regular inspections to identify and address any potential issues or areas for improvement.
  • Implement corrective actions and preventive measures to maintain high-quality workmanship and safety standards.
  • Collaboration and Communication :
  • Liaise with clients, contractors, and internal stakeholders to provide updates on project status, resolve issues, and address any concerns.
  • Collaborate with the procurement team to ensure timely availability of materials and equipment for projects.
  • Communicate effectively with team members, providing clear instructions, feedback, and guidance to facilitate efficient project execution.

Requirements :

  • Valid electrical license / certification (REQUIREMENT)
  • Extensive experience (minimum 10 years) as an electrician, with a proven track record of successfully leading electrical projects.
  • In-depth knowledge of electrical systems, codes, regulations, and industry best practices.
  • Strong technical skills and the ability to assess project requirements accurately.
  • Excellent leadership and team management abilities.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Attention to detail and strong problem-solving capabilities.
  • Ability to work well under pressure and meet project deadlines.
